Amentum is seeking a mid-level, multi-craft Industrial Maintenance Technician/ First Responder for our team in Vance, AL. This industrial maintenance technician is responsible for providing an intermediate level of mechanical or electrical expertise in performing preventive and corrective maintenance activities associated with the material handling equipment and equipment charging stations in a large industrial environment.
Job Responsibility:
First Responder for AGT (Automated Guided Tugger) break down calls
Diagnoses, troubleshoots, maintains, and repairs material handling equipment, charging stations, and control systems
Conducts preventive maintenance inspections and performs required preventive maintenance actions as outlined by the equipment manufacturer
Troubleshoots, repairs, and maintains equipment control systems
Demonstrates ability to utilize meggers, voltmeters, multi-meters, etc.
Troubleshoots and repairs electrical and automation issues
Performs preventive maintenance on equipment as scheduled in the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S)
Responds and provides service and feedback to the customer on all work orders while assuring compliance to codes, regulations and industry standards
Understands company policies and enforces safety regulations
Safely performs functions of the position including following proper safety guidelines such as job hazard analysis and lockout/tagout procedures and wearing PPE as required
Promotes and adheres to AECOM Safety Structure
Demonstrates attention to detail, good comprehensive and analytical skills, and excellent organizational skills
Maintains a strict schedule in order to be successful in the assignment, yet demonstrates flexibility in the day-to-day activities and scheduling for the benefit of the customer
Other duties as assigned
